Apps like rely on outdated computer terminology to market themselves to users experiencing device slowdowns. Because flash memory does not suffer from mechanical fragmentation, running a defrag utility on a smartphone is counterproductive and harmful to the hardware lifespan. To keep your phone running fast safely, rely on Android’s built-in storage management, keep your storage below 85% capacity, and avoid downloading untrusted APK files from outside official app stores.

In the PC world, defragmentation (defragging) is a legendary maintenance ritual. For decades, users fired up tools like Defraggler or the native Windows Disk Defragmenter to reorganize fragmented hard drive data, boosting speed and longevity. Naturally, when Android matured into a full-fledged computing platform, users began asking: Does Android need defragging too?
Flash memory has a limited number of "write" cycles. Defragmenting forces the system to move files around constantly, wearing out the hardware faster.
